Former Dhenkanal MLA Nabin Nanda Joins Congress

Bhubaneswar: Former BJD Leader and Dhenkanal MLA Nabin Nanda on Wednesday joined the Congress party ahead of the first phase of general elections in the state on April 11.

Nanda joined the grand old party in the presence of Odisha Pradesh Congress Committee (OPCC) Chief Niranjan Patnaik and other party workers at the Congress Bhawan here.

The OPCC President welcomed Nanda and said that his presence will strengthen the party. Taking to Twitter, he wrote- “Today Former BJD MLA Shri Nabin Nanda joined Congress with many of his supporters. I welcome them to the Congress family.”

Noteworthy, Nabin Nanda was expelled from the BJD in July last year after he was arrested from a spa in Kolkata where a sex racket was being operated in the name of massage services.
